引言

随着互联网技术的飞速发展,Web前端开发已经成为数字化时代的重要技能之一。掌握Web前端技术,不仅能够帮助个人在职场中脱颖而出,还能为企业和组织带来创新和发展的机遇。本文将深入探讨高效学习Web前端的方法和实战技巧,帮助读者开启数字化未来之路。

第一部分:Web前端基础知识

1.1 HTML:网页结构的基石

HTML(HyperText Markup Language)是构建网页的基本语言,负责网页的结构和内容。学习HTML,需要掌握以下知识点:

  • 标签的使用和属性设置
  • 布局和样式的基本概念
  • 表单和多媒体元素的使用

1.2 CSS:网页美学的灵魂

CSS(Cascading Style Sheets)用于控制网页的样式和布局。学习CSS,需要掌握以下知识点:

  • 选择器和属性
  • 布局技术(如Flexbox和Grid)
  • 响应式设计

1.3 JavaScript:网页交互的魔法师

JavaScript是一种客户端脚本语言,用于实现网页的动态效果和交互功能。学习JavaScript,需要掌握以下知识点:

  • 基本语法和数据结构
  • 函数和对象
  • 常用库和框架(如jQuery和React)

第二部分:高效学习策略

2.1 制定学习计划

为了高效学习Web前端,首先需要制定一个合理的学习计划。以下是一些建议:

  • 确定学习目标:明确自己学习Web前端的目的和期望成果。
  • 制定学习路径:根据个人基础和兴趣,选择合适的学习资源。
  • 分阶段学习:将学习内容分解为多个阶段,逐步完成。

2.2 选择优质学习资源

优质的学习资源对于提高学习效率至关重要。以下是一些建议:

  • 在线教程和课程:如慕课网、极客学院等。
  • 开源项目:参与开源项目,了解实际开发流程。
  • 技术社区:如CSDN、Stack Overflow等,获取行业动态和解决方案。

2.3 实践与总结

理论知识是基础,但实际操作才是检验学习成果的关键。以下是一些建议:

  • 练习编写代码:通过实际编写代码,加深对知识点的理解。
  • 参与项目实战:尝试参与实际项目,提高解决问题的能力。
  • 定期总结:总结学习过程中的心得体会,不断调整学习策略。

第三部分:实战技巧

3.1 版本控制

掌握版本控制工具(如Git)对于Web前端开发至关重要。以下是一些建议:

  • 学习Git的基本操作:如创建仓库、提交代码、分支管理等。
  • 使用Git进行团队协作:提高代码质量和开发效率。

3.2 前端框架和库

熟悉前端框架和库(如React、Vue、Angular)可以大大提高开发效率。以下是一些建议:

  • 选择适合自己的框架:根据项目需求和团队习惯选择合适的框架。
  • 学习框架的原理和用法:提高对框架的理解和应用能力。

3.3 性能优化

性能优化是Web前端开发的重要环节。以下是一些建议:

  • 优化代码:减少不必要的代码和资源,提高页面加载速度。
  • 使用缓存:利用浏览器缓存和服务器缓存,提高访问速度。
  • 优化图片和视频:选择合适的格式和大小,减少加载时间。

结论

掌握Web前端技术,是开启数字化未来之路的关键。通过制定合理的学习计划、选择优质的学习资源、实践与总结,以及掌握实战技巧,相信读者能够迅速提升自己的Web前端技能,为未来的职业发展打下坚实基础。